It is not possible to configure the mouse buttons. Right now it is possible to change the center/window values of an image by using the center mouse button. This works also when a different function (e.g. stack mode) is active in the toolbar.

I'm not entirely sure what you're asking. You can set the viewer window to be spanned across two displays using the dual display mode under "Additional settings". Make sure that the viewer window is not maximized when you activate the option. You may have to drag the window into the preferred position. Do not use the maximize state afterwards to keep the dual display mode.
This way you can easily compare two studies, using two displays.
